A beautiful forested area surrounded by suburban sprawl. Great area to take a short hike. While on an early morning dog walk, see saw both deer and rabbits. The main loop is .7 mi with multiple entrances, so you could veer off the path and explore the suburban neighborhood then link back up with the tail again. There are also several park benches, so if hiking is not your thing, you can always just sit down and relax surrounded by nature.

Northridge Park and trail system grants is a peaceful, wooded area for comfortable run or hike with easy access to Klispun Trail through Barkley Tunnel, Silver Beach Trail and Big Rock Garden. The area is tucked back northwest of Railroad Trail. Reaching Northridge by way of Klipsun Trail is a bit of a climb, but well worth the effort.
